Abstract

Urea precipitation method has been developed as an important approach for the preparation of inorganic particles with defined morphology and composition. In present work, we provide survey of the technological developments and achievements mainly on the application of the urea precipitation method in preparation of advanced ceramics powders. Stable pH obtained during the thermal decomposition of urea in aqueous solution make it quite promising for the precise composition control of ultrafine powders. The decomposition mechanism of urea in aqueous solution is discussed before a systematic description of its application in the preparation of monodispersed particles with unary/binary composition. Clear decomposition mechanism of urea provides researchers a possibility to analyze the evolution process of ultrafine particles from its initial forming period. Finally, the application potential and future prospects of this method, such as preparation of core–shell particle with designed composition and precipitation kinetics study, are outlined.
